How to Make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ars
Preheat and Prepare Your Baking Pan
First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F. This ensures every bite bakes evenly and turns out just right. While the oven warms up, line an 8×8-inch baking pan with parchment paper. I like to leave some paper hanging over the edges for easy removal later. Next, spray the parchment with cooking spray. This step is crucial—it prevents any sticky disasters, ensuring your luscious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ars come out perfectly. Trust me; the last thing you want is your beautiful dessert to battle the pan!
Make the Brownie Base
Now, let’s whip up that brownie base! In a mixing bowl, combine the granulated sugar, brown sugar, and eggs. Mix these ingredients until fluffy. Then, add the vegetable oil and stir until well blended. In another bowl, whisk together the flour, salt, and cocoa powder. Gradually add this dry mixture to the sugar and egg mix, stirring until just combined. Don’t forget the chocolate chips! Fold those in gently for bursts of melty goodness throughout. Spread the thick batter evenly into your prepared pan. It’s decadent and oh-so-chocolatey!
Bake the Brownie Layer
Pop your brownie batter into the oven and let it bake for about 20 minutes. Keep an eye on it! The surface should look set, with a toothpick coming out with a few moist crumbs attached. Remember, it’s better to slightly underbake than overbake, as the brownies will firm up as they cool. Patience is key here! While it may be tempting to dive right in, allow the brownies to cool completely. This prevents any melting disasters when you add the peanut butter layer!
Prepare the Peanut Butter Layer
Once the brownie base has cooled, it’s time to shift focus to that creamy peanut butter layer. In a mixing bowl, beat the room temperature cream cheese and creamy peanut butter together until smooth and fluffy. The room temperature is key here; it ensures that everything combines beautifully, leaving no lumps behind. Next, mix in the confectioners’ sugar and vanilla until well incorporated. The final touch? Fold in the Cool Whip gently. This creates a light and dreamy topping. Spread this mixture evenly over your cooled brownies, and get ready for the magic!
Combine and Chill
Now, for the moment of zen! Carefully spread the peanut butter mixture over those rich brownies. It’s like a soft blanket of peanut buttery goodness! Once that’s done, place the pan in the refrigerator for at least two hours. This step is vital; chilling allows the layers to set properly. Your patience will be rewarded with perfectly layered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ars that you simply can’t resist! Trust me, the wait is worth it.

FAQs about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ars
Got questions? Don’t worry; I’ve got answers! Here are some of the most frequently asked questions about my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ars.
How do I store these brownie bars?
Simply keep them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They’ll stay fresh for about a week—if they last that long!
Can I freeze the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ars?
Absolutely! Just w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and then foil before freezing. They can be enjoyed straight from the freezer or thawed in the fridge.
What can I use instead of cream cheese?
If you’re looking for a dairy-free alternative, vegan cream cheese works great. Alternatively, silken tofu can be blended for a lighter option.
Are these bars suitable for kids?
Definitely! Kids adore the combination of chocolate and peanut butter. Plus, they’re a fun and creative treat for birthday parties or school events!
Can I make these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ars in advance?
You bet! In fact, making them a day ahead enhances the flavors as they chill. Just remember to cover them well so they remain perfectly divine!

Peanut Butter Cheesecake Brownie Bars
- Total Time: 2 hours 40 minutes
- Yield: 16 bars 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Delicious peanut butter cheesecake brownie bars with a rich brownie base and creamy peanut butter topping.
Ingredients
- Brownie Layer:
- 2/3 cup granulated Sugar
- 1/2 cup packed brown s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up all purpose flour
- 1/2 cup cocoa powder
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ips
- Peanut Butter Layer:
- 8 ounce cream cheese, room temp.
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 cup confectioners s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la
- 1 cup cool whip
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F and line an 8×8-inch pan with parchment paper and spray with cooking spray.
- Combine the sugars and eggs together in a bowl, then add the oil and stir well.
- In a separate bowl combine the flour, salt and cocoa, then stir into the sugar mixture.
- Stir in the chocolate chips, then spread evenly in the pan.
- Place in the oven and bake for 20 minutes. The brownies may have a little lingering dough when a toothpick is inserted.
- Let cool completely before adding the peanut butter layer. This could take at least an hour.
- Beat the cream cheese and peanut butter together with a hand mixer till whipped and creamy.
- Add the powdered sugar and vanilla, mix it in with the mixer.
- Fold in the cool whip, then spread over the cooled brownies.
- Place the pan in the refrigerator for 2 hours before serving.
- Cut and serve.
Notes
- Make sure the cream cheese is at room temperature for easier mixing.
- Allow the brownies to cool completely to prevent melting the peanut butter layer.
- Store any leftovers in the refrigerator.
